Guildford Mourns Teen Stabbing Victim, Tributes Left
The community of Guildford is mourning the tragic death of a 15-year-old boy, who was killed in a stabbing incident. In the wake of this devastating event, numerous tributes, including flowers, have been left by members of the public at the scene, serving as a poignant expression of grief and remembrance for the young victim. The incident prompted a significant police presence and likely led to the closure of parts of Stoke Park, which has now reportedly fully reopened, signaling a step towards normalcy for the area following the tragic events.
